Asynchronous SNMP (asynio, v3arch)
|
|
==================================
|
|
|
|
The :mod:`asyncio` module first appeared in standard library since
|
|
Python 3.3 (in provisional basis). Its main design feature is that it
|
|
makes asynchronous code looking like synchronous one thus eliminating
|
|
"callback hell".
|
|
|
|
With `asyncio` built-in facilities, you could run many SNMP queries
|
|
in parallel and/or sequentially, interleave SNMP queries with other I/O
|
|
operations. See `asyncio resources <http://asyncio.org>`_
|
|
repository for other `asyncio`-compatible modules.
|
|
|
|
In most examples approximate analogues of well known Net-SNMP snmp* tools
|
|
command line options are shown. That may help those readers who, by chance
|
|
are familiar with Net-SNMP tools, better understanding what example code doe
